我想将单个网页(或网页的一部分)保存为我的乳胶文档中的矢量图形。
如何将网页保存为矢量图像?
答案1
使用转PDF正如 Giles 在上面的评论中所建议的那样。它使用 webkit 从命令行将您的页面呈现为矢量 PDF。
(我将这个答案提升为顶级答案,因为这个宝贵的答案很可能会在混乱的评论中被忽视)。
答案2
我想你的意思是单身的网络页,而不是整个网站!
也许您可以从浏览器打印为 PDF 文件,或者打印\includegraphic
PDF 文件,或者将其转换为 PDF 文件,*.eps
或者*.svg
使用某些实用程序?
当然,问题是印刷您将获得看起来像是要打印的输出。通常这毕竟是您想要的...
如果您进入浏览器的打印设置,您可以指示它打印背景颜色和图像,并关闭页眉/页脚文本 - 这是最简单的部分。但是,它不会绕过页面本身为改善打印输出所做的任何操作:例如,维基百科有一组自定义样式,用于打印时删除多余的文本和图形(页眉、侧边栏、编辑/展开链接等)。
你可能更喜欢这样:https://addons.mozilla.org/en-US/firefox/addon/save-as-pdf/
答案3
一个似乎涵盖此用例的项目似乎是 WebVector 项目,它使用 CSSBox 作为渲染引擎:http://cssbox.sourceforge.net/webvector/
这使用 WebKit 并将其保存为 PDF,这可能更准确:http://wkhtmltopdf.org/
答案4
尝试这项服务。从网站创建您在浏览器中看到的矢量 PDF。https://lomotoh.com/(我与该网站有联系)